  • During the The Young and the Restless 50th anniversary party red carpet, a few of the OG stars chatted with Michael Fairman in this exclusive interview for the Michael Fairman Channel.
    Two of Y&R's original cast members, Janice Lynde (Leslie Brooks) and Jaime Lyn Bauer (Lorie Brooks) were joined by John McCook, who played their love interest on the show, Lance Prentiss.
    Janice and Jaime were with the show from its inception in 1973, and they were later joined by John who debuted in 1975. He later joined the cast of The Bold and the Beautiful where he has played Eric Forrester for 36 years.
    During the conversation, Janice and Jaime talk about the Brooks sisters storylines, the on-screen triangle between them, and the trio share how Y&R back then was a very musical soap, and each of them sang on the daytime drama series, while Lynde was also an accomplished pianist.
    Later, they pay tribute to the late Victoria Mallory, who replaced Janice in the role of Leslie, and recall inside stories of their time on the show and what led to their ultimate departures.
